The dark magic hour refers to a particular time of day when the lighting conditions are perfect for capturing photographs with a mysterious and ethereal atmosphere. It is typically the time just before sunrise or just after sunset when the sky is still dimly lit, but there is enough light to create a captivating scene. During this mystical hour, the colors in the sky take on a deep and rich quality, with hues of purples, blues, and oranges dominating the scene. The soft, diffused light casts long shadows and adds a sense of drama to the surroundings. Photographers often find the dark magic hour to be a magical time for capturing landscape and nature photographs. It allows them to create captivating images with a unique ambiance that is difficult to replicate during other times of the day.

Capturing the dark magic hour requires careful timing and planning. Photographers must be aware of the exact timing of sunrise and sunset in their location to ensure they are on-site at the right moment. The weather conditions also play a crucial role, as an overcast sky or heavy rain can greatly affect the light quality. To make the most of the dark magic hour, photographers often use certain techniques such as long-exposure photography to capture the movement of clouds or water, as well as the use of filters to enhance the colors and contrast in the scene.
